Liechtenstein, Dukedom. An Order Of Merit, Gold Medal, C.1940 Auction Archive the void of the crown(Frstlich Liechtensteinischer Verdienstorden). Instituted in 1937 by Duke Franz I. (Issued 1937 Present). In bronze gilt, a hollow four armed cross pattee with pebbled arms, the obverse with a central blue enameled medallion bearing the gilt monogram L for Liechtenstein, within a red enameled ring, the reverse with a similar central medallion inscribed the gilt royal monogram of Franz I, surrounded by a red ring of enamels, measuring 55. 56 mm (w) x
